Job Description

We have an exciting opportunity for the right person who is a results driven individual to step into the role of Production Manager.  The successful candidate will lead and develop the team and ensure the right people and skills are available to deliver and meet production and delivery targets on time, to cost and specification, in line with food safety and legality, and health and safety standards.  

 

Key Responsibilities:

  • Developing a customer focused approach to ensure the full delivery of products to meet requirements
  • Ensuring products meet specification and are regularly monitored for taste, appearance and quality
  • Monitoring key cost control areas and continually reviewing functional KPI’s to ensure site meets budgets
  • Developing and promoting brand standards and harmonisation, contributing to functional, cross-functional and group meetings to achieve business objectives
  • Identifying and evaluating opportunities for improving efficiencies across the site
  • Utilising available information to identify opportunities for continuous improvement
  • Driving the standard of Food Safety/ Health and Safety across the site
  • Supporting the development of manpower and succession plans for the site and dealing pro-actively with behaviour and performances issues
  • Participating in recruitment and selection activities as appropriate
  • Leading a team in line with the values, with high visibility, promoting a culture of achievement and responsibility
  • Carrying out PDR’s agreeing with targets and objectives and conducting regular 1 to 1’s
  • Dealing with Performance Management activities within the team
  • Coordinating the maintenance of systems and procedures in respect of food safety in line with the requirements of the BRC Global Standard for Food Safety.  
  • Ensuring communication is effective and in line with agreed strategy

Benefits

  • Our Greggs Employee discount Scheme is very generous, offering you up to 50% off our food
  • Your holiday entitlement starts with 26 days, in addition to Bank Holidays, which increases with service up to a maximum of 30 days after 25 years’ service (pro-rata for part time)
  • After 6 months service you may be eligible  for our profit share scheme
  • You will be invited to participate in our Management Bonus Scheme which is worth up to 7.5% of your salary, subject to the Company meeting certain performance criteria.
  • You will automatically join our Greggs pension scheme which is a fantastic way to save for your retirement and allows you to benefit from employer contributions and tax advantages
  • Defined contribution management pension scheme
  • Death in service benefit which provides a lump-sum payment equal to 4 times your year’s salary

Other benefits include

  • Private Medical Insurance which is free for you and subsidised for your dependants
  • Permanent Health Insurance which is a replacement income scheme
  • Share Save and Share Incentive Schemes
  • Childcare Vouchers
  • Employee Assistance Programme
  • Cycle to Work Scheme
